Mar Vista Gardens, Culver City,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Mar Vista Gardens?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Mar Vista Gardens | $2,305 | $1,750 | $3,073 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Mar Vista Gardens | $2,996 | $1,197 | $4,840 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Mar Vista Gardens | $4,015 | $2,250 | $5,790 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Mar Vista Gardens | $4,767 | $3,116 | $6,638 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Mar Vista Gardens
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Mar Vista Gardens?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Mar Vista Gardens está en 12450 Culver Blvd listado en $1,750.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Mar Vista Gardens?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Mar Vista Gardens es $2,305.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Mar Vista Gardens 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Mar Vista Gardens es una unidad de 601 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,814 en Kinley West LA.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Mar Vista Gardens?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Mar Vista Gardens es actualmente de 465 pies cuadrados.
